Software Guidance & Assistance, Inc., (SGA), is searching for a Sr. Project Manager (Products) for a contract assignment with one of our premier financial services clients in New York, NY.

Responsibilities :
- Preparing concise Markets activity/progress reports adjusted to the audience
- Providing check and challenge on activity/progress reports by other functions
- Utilizing best practice PMO methodology (e.g., maintain plans, risk and issues, etc) that fit stakeholders needs
- Driving end results of the project as a representative of Markets
- Facilitating remediation-related engagement with the Markets product lines
- Proactively tracking project progress against goals
- Possess the knowledge, skills and experience to be able to recognize when problems surface or potential problems are looming
- Clearly articulating problems, bringing the right people together to solve problems and knowing when it has been properly addressed and closed
- Promotes partner involvement through effectively communicating project status across a varied set of stakeholders
- Defining, teaching, and enforcing the use of good project management practices (i.e., resolving complex, interdependent activities into tasks and sub-tasks that are documented, monitored and controlled)
- Articulate and effective communicator, both orally and in writing
- Extremely detail oriented and ability to both investigate deeply into content of the material but also look across the portfolio
- Strong interpersonal skills, with evidence of working in collaboration across large organizations, including a proactive and 'no surprises' approach in communicating issues/requests/escalation.
- Ability to drive progress issue-by-issue and ensure deadlines are met
- Experience managing inter-department dependencies (e.g., working with Compliance, Technology, Internal Audit, etc.)
- Ability to plan and organize, working well both in a team setting and independently.
- Strong leadership skills with a proven track record in driving positive and sustained change
- Demonstrated ability to think critically, strategically and analytically and to creatively problem solve
- Proven prior experience/successes
- Proficiency in Word, Excel, PPT, MS Project
- Experience on regulatory programs a plus
- Markets knowledge (e.g., risk and controls, trade lifecycle, products, etc.) a plus
